arm-trusted-firmware/fdts
Alexei Fedorov 003faaa59f FVP: Add support for passing platform's topology to DTS
This patch adds support for passing FVP platform's topology
configuration to DTS files for compilation, which allows to
build DTBs with correct number of clusters and CPUs.
This removes non-existing clusters/CPUs from the compiled
device tree blob and fixes reported Linux errors when trying
to power on absent CPUs/PEs.
If DTS file is passed using FVP_HW_CONFIG_DTS build option from
the platform's makefile, FVP_CLUSTER_COUNT, FVP_MAX_CPUS_PER_CLUSTER
and FVP_MAX_PE_PER_CPU parameters are used, otherwise CI script will
use the default values from the corresponding DTS file.

Change-Id: Idcb45dc6ad5e3eaea18573aff1a01c9344404ab3
Signed-off-by: Alexei Fedorov <Alexei.Fedorov@arm.com>
2020-05-19 13:16:22 +00:00
..
a5ds.dts fdts: a5ds: Fix for the system timer issue. 2020-04-17 21:12:15 +01:00
corstone700.dts corstone700: updating the kernel arguments to support initramfs 2020-03-24 11:12:14 +00:00
fvp-base-gicv2-psci-aarch32.dts FVP: Add support for passing platform's topology to DTS 2020-05-19 13:16:22 +00:00
fvp-base-gicv2-psci.dts FVP: Add support for passing platform's topology to DTS 2020-05-19 13:16:22 +00:00
fvp-base-gicv3-psci-1t.dts FVP: Add support for passing platform's topology to DTS 2020-05-19 13:16:22 +00:00
fvp-base-gicv3-psci-aarch32-1t.dts FVP: Add support for passing platform's topology to DTS 2020-05-19 13:16:22 +00:00
fvp-base-gicv3-psci-aarch32-common.dtsi FVP: Add support for passing platform's topology to DTS 2020-05-19 13:16:22 +00:00
fvp-base-gicv3-psci-aarch32.dts FVP: Add support for passing platform's topology to DTS 2020-05-19 13:16:22 +00:00
fvp-base-gicv3-psci-common.dtsi FVP: Add support for passing platform's topology to DTS 2020-05-19 13:16:22 +00:00
fvp-base-gicv3-psci-dynamiq-2t.dts FVP: Add support for passing platform's topology to DTS 2020-05-19 13:16:22 +00:00
fvp-base-gicv3-psci-dynamiq-common.dtsi FVP: Add support for passing platform's topology to DTS 2020-05-19 13:16:22 +00:00
fvp-base-gicv3-psci-dynamiq.dts FVP: Add support for passing platform's topology to DTS 2020-05-19 13:16:22 +00:00
fvp-base-gicv3-psci.dts FVP: Add support for passing platform's topology to DTS 2020-05-19 13:16:22 +00:00
fvp-defs-dynamiq.dtsi FVP: Add support for passing platform's topology to DTS 2020-05-19 13:16:22 +00:00
fvp-defs.dtsi FVP: Add support for passing platform's topology to DTS 2020-05-19 13:16:22 +00:00
fvp-foundation-gicv2-psci.dts FVP: Add support for passing platform's topology to DTS 2020-05-19 13:16:22 +00:00
fvp-foundation-gicv3-psci.dts FVP: Add support for passing platform's topology to DTS 2020-05-19 13:16:22 +00:00
fvp-foundation-motherboard.dtsi Remove dtc warnings 2018-04-24 08:30:01 +01:00
fvp-ve-Cortex-A5x1.dts Replace dts includes with C preprocessor syntax 2020-01-14 10:30:38 +01:00
fvp-ve-Cortex-A7x1.dts Replace dts includes with C preprocessor syntax 2020-01-14 10:30:38 +01:00
rtsm_ve-motherboard-aarch32.dtsi Remove dtc warnings 2018-04-24 08:30:01 +01:00
rtsm_ve-motherboard.dtsi Remove dtc warnings 2018-04-24 08:30:01 +01:00
stm32mp15-ddr.dtsi fdts: Fix DTC warnings for STM32MP1 platform 2019-04-26 19:17:17 +05:30
stm32mp15-ddr3-1x4Gb-1066-binG.dtsi fdts: stm32mp1: realign device tree files with internal devs 2019-06-17 14:03:51 +02:00
stm32mp15-ddr3-2x4Gb-1066-binG.dtsi fdts: stm32mp1: realign device tree files with internal devs 2019-06-17 14:03:51 +02:00
stm32mp157-pinctrl.dtsi fdts: stm32mp1: update for FMC2 pin muxing 2020-01-20 11:32:59 +01:00
stm32mp157a-avenger96.dts fdts: stm32mp1: move FDCAN to PLL4_R 2019-10-03 11:17:40 +02:00
stm32mp157a-dk1.dts fdts: stm32mp1: move FDCAN to PLL4_R 2019-10-03 11:17:40 +02:00
stm32mp157c-dk2.dts stm32mp1: introduce STM32MP1 discovery boards 2019-02-14 11:20:23 +01:00
stm32mp157c-ed1.dts fdts: stm32mp1: move FDCAN to PLL4_R 2019-10-03 11:17:40 +02:00
stm32mp157c-ev1.dts fdts: stm32mp1: remove second QSPI flash instance 2020-01-20 11:32:59 +01:00
stm32mp157c-security.dtsi stm32mp1: add authentication support for stm32image 2019-09-23 09:48:07 +00:00
stm32mp157c.dtsi fdts: stm32mp1: realign device tree files with internal devs 2019-06-17 14:03:51 +02:00
stm32mp157caa-pinctrl.dtsi stm32mp1: update device tree files 2019-01-18 15:45:08 +01:00
stm32mp157cac-pinctrl.dtsi stm32mp1: introduce STM32MP1 discovery boards 2019-02-14 11:20:23 +01:00